OpenAI의 안전 모범 사례는 오용 가능성을 제한하기 위한 것입니다.
요청에 안전 식별자를 함께 보내면 OpenAI가 악용을 모니터링하고 탐지하는 데 도움이 되는 유용한 수단이 될 수 있습니다. 이를 통해 애플리케이션에서 정책 위반이 감지될 경우 OpenAI가 팀에 더 실행 가능한 피드백을 제공할 수 있습니다.
안전 식별자는 각 사용자를 고유하게 식별하는 문자열이어야 합니다. 사용자 이름이나 이메일 주소를 해시 처리하여 식별 정보를 저희에게 보내지 않도록 하세요. 로그인하지 않은 사용자에게 제품 미리보기를 제공하는 경우에는 대신 세션 ID를 보낼 수 있습니다.
안전 식별자는 동일한 목적을 위해 이전에 사용되던 user 매개변수를 대체합니다.
API 요청에 safety_identifier 매개변수로 안전 식별자를 포함하세요:
Python — Chat Completions API
from openai import OpenAI
client = OpenAI()
response = client.chat.completions.create(
model="gpt-5-mini",
messages=[
{"role": "user", "content": "This is a test"}
],
safety_identifier="user_123456"
)Python — Responses API
from openai import OpenAI
client = OpenAI()
response = client.responses.create(
model="gpt-5-mini",
input="This is a test",
safety_identifier="user_123456"
)